This charming café on York Blvd is a delightful spot with both indoor and outdoor seating options, plus reliable WiFi. The interior is beautifully decorated with elements of car culture, featuring motorcycles and vintage road signs. They frequently host community events, including the Makina car club car show, Carrera Arroyo, and Mercado, which add to the vibrant atmosphere alongside various shops on York. I've been coming to Highland Cafe for years (may I dare say a decade even). Not only is the coffee good, but the breakfast/brunch/lunch menus are fantastic. Every ingredient is always fresh and perfectly paired.
My go-to's are the Sunrise Breakfast Bowl, Huevos Rancheros, Cali Burrito, or their Wrap special. On occasion, a mimosa pairs well with any of my above choices.
Indeed, the friendly yet laid back local vibes, along with the hard work that Arnie puts into his restaurant is testament to why this establishment is a Highland Park staple.
